This PR deprecates the last remaining vectorized abs2 method in favor of compact broadcast syntax. Ref. #16285, #17302, #18495, #18512, #18513, and #18558. Best!

(Unlike with float, real, etc., the remaining vectorized abs2 method never aliases its input. This PR should be less controversial than #18495, #18512, and #18513 as a result.)
